Cobble is a good spot with nice accomations on site, also Blue Mountain in Collingwood where you can stay at the The Blue Mountain Village and they are multiple courses over there there a decent, Monterra, Cranberry, Oslerbrook, Battueax and Lora Bay creek to name a few. Have fun!
How about Niagara Falls? Thirty-six excellent holes at Legends, and Grand Niagara is very good too. Lots to do at night (assuming a post-COVID world). Or for something a little more low key, how about Belleville? Black Bear Ridge and Trillium Wood are practically next door to each other, and are both quite good.

My group stays and plays at Bellemere Winds on Rice Lake just outside of Peterborough. Small trailer like cottages right on the golf course. 36 holes/day and cocktails/cards at night...nothing better.
I like to give a shout out to my area (Windsor). Windsor - Essex County has lots of courses, and Tourism Windsor-Essex has a stay and play package - plus you have our casino on the waterfront, and Pt Pelee National Park and wineries galore!
Royal Ashburn, 4 cabins, on site food included, large putting green area right out front of the cabins. Played there this summer, passed by the cabins with 16 guys, cornhole games, chipping putting games, music, I was jealous, they seemed To be having a great time. Now, will admit, living 20 minutes from RA, couldn’t sell the wife on me being gone for 4 days on a golf trip so close, but if you’re outside the Durham region, haven’t seen a better onsite set up anywhere!

Don't forget Peninsula Lakes...top rated value course in Canada (2021)...think it was in the top 15 in 2020. Played there in June 2021, less than $100 tax and cart included. Nice course at that rate. Better than Legends in my opinion. Played that, both Legends courses and Whirlpool in 3 days.
